The ongoing garbage crisis here in Lebanon has brought people together across sectarian lines–everyone’s tired of the trash. Many streets aren’t even passable due to the mountains of refuse erupting in all directions. Today in Beirut, the government failed once again to find a solution to the protracted garbage crisis. As you can imagine, the smell throughout the city is awful–and now foreign governments are warning their citizens of the environmental, health, and travel risks of the 11-day crisis. In its travel advisory, the British government now notes the “higher than usual levels of air pollution in Beirut” from the buildup of trash throughout the city.
